Transaction 30962a95948a0a979f79f13c7213df49fafaba0c1ba47e13cdb6d23aca1a661a
1 Input
1 Output
-
30962a95948a0a979f79f13c7213df49fafaba0c1ba47e13cdb6d23aca1a661a:0
- value
- 30980376
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d25b9e80a1ad3ec8e0a0fffeadea9372138ccb3d OP_EQUAL
- address
- 3LsHadyW673svDqfVVRGY8Vbh8Ckm3zoKn